Middlebrooks Signs One Year Contract With Denver
19th May, 2006 - 11:50 am
Denver Post - His career has been a dissapointing one capped by his recent release from the lowly San Francisco 49ers. Yesterday, cornerback Willie Middlebrooks signed a one-year contract with the team that drafted him in the first-round in 2001.

"Willie would like to live up to his opportunity he had when he was first drafted to the club," said Middlebrooks' agent, Drew Rosenhaus. "This gives him another chance." [READ]
